What Size Kid Slide Bunk Bed Fits in a Small Bedroom? A Space & Clearance Guide

Planning to buy a kid slide bunk bed for a small bedroom? Learn how to calculate the exact floor space, slide projection, ceiling clearance, and safety buffers you need before purchasing.

A kid slide bunk bed can turn a standard small bedroom into an active, engaging play space, but installing one requires precise spatial planning to avoid turning the room into an impassable obstacle course. To determine if a slide bunk bed will fit in your space, you must look far beyond the standard rectangular footprint of a traditional bed frame. While a standard single-over-single frame typically requires a floor area of about 100 centimeters wide by 200 centimeters long, the addition of a slide extends the necessary width or length by an extra 120 to 150 centimeters. Consequently, you will need a minimum clear floor area of at least 250 centimeters by 200 centimeters, plus an additional safety landing zone. Balancing these dimensions with the room’s layout is the key to ensuring both fun and safety.

Baseline Dimensions for Standard Kid Slide Bunk Beds

Before evaluating the slide itself, you must establish the baseline footprint of the bunk bed frame. In the Philippines, most children’s bunk beds are designed around standard single (often 36 inches by 75 inches, or roughly 91 centimeters by 190 centimeters) or twin mattress sizes. When you account for the wooden or metal frame structure, the actual outer dimensions of the bed will be larger than the mattress. A typical single-over-single wooden bunk bed frame generally measures between 100 to 110 centimeters in width and 200 to 210 centimeters in length.

These baseline dimensions only represent the closed rectangular box of the bed. Design variations can quickly expand this footprint. For instance, frames featuring built-in storage drawers at the base, integrated shelving on the side, or wider safety guardrails will add several centimeters to the overall width and length. If the bed uses stairs with built-in cubbies instead of a vertical ladder, the length of the setup can easily increase by another 40 to 50 centimeters.

Because of these variations, you should never rely solely on generic mattress sizes when planning your layout. Always request the manufacturer’s detailed specification sheet to obtain the exact outer frame dimensions.

Additionally, consider the physical logistics of bringing the bed into your home. In compact living spaces, such as high-rise condominiums in metro areas, delivery access is a common bottleneck. You must verify the dimensions of your building’s service elevator, narrow hallways, and bedroom doorways. Ensure that the flat-packed boxes or pre-assembled components can safely clear these tight turns and entryways before making a purchase.

Finally, pay close attention to the structural material and joints of the frame. In the humid tropical climate of the Philippines, solid wood frames can expand and contract, while metal frames may be susceptible to rust if not treated with a high-quality protective finish. Inspect the manufacturer’s care instructions to ensure the materials are suited for your home’s humidity levels, and verify that all joints and anchoring hardware are robust enough to prevent wobbling, which is especially critical when a slide is attached.

Calculating Floor Space and Clearance for the Slide

The slide is the defining feature of this bed type, but it is also the element that demands the most floor space. When a slide is attached to a bunk bed, it extends outward at an angle, creating a diagonal projection from the side or the end of the frame. This projection is the horizontal distance from the outer edge of the bed frame to the very tip of the slide’s bottom exit.

On average, a standard slide projects outward by 120 to 150 centimeters. This means that if your bed frame is 100 centimeters wide and the slide projects from the side, the total width requirement instantly jumps to 220 or 250 centimeters. You must measure this projection carefully to ensure it does not collide with adjacent walls, built-in wardrobes, or study desks.

Equally important is the safety landing zone at the bottom of the slide. A child exiting the slide does not stop instantly at the edge of the plastic or wood; they need space to land, stand up, and walk away safely. You must maintain a clear, unobstructed buffer of at least 90 to 100 centimeters at the foot of the slide. This landing zone must remain completely free of toys, storage bins, sharp furniture corners, and primary walking paths to prevent trips and collisions.

The angle of the slide also plays a major role in how much space is consumed. A steeper slide angle will have a shorter horizontal projection, saving valuable floor space, but it will result in a faster, more abrupt descent. Conversely, a gentler, more gradual slide is easier on younger children but will extend much further into the room, consuming a larger portion of the floor.

To visualize this in your specific room, consult the product’s assembly manual or specification sheet. Look for the exact measurement of the slide’s projection and map out how that diagonal line interacts with the rest of your furniture. If the slide is reversible, meaning it can be mounted on either the left or right side of the frame, you have more flexibility to adapt the bed to your room’s unique layout.

Verifying Ceiling Height and Top Bunk Headroom

While floor space is critical for the slide, vertical space is the defining factor for the bunk bed itself. In the Philippines, standard residential ceiling heights typically range from 2.4 to 2.7 meters, though some older homes or modern condominium units with drop ceilings or decorative beams may have even less clearance. You must measure your floor-to-ceiling height precisely before selecting a slide bunk bed.

To calculate the usable headroom for the child sleeping on the top bunk, use a simple subtraction formula. Start with your total ceiling height, then subtract the height of the bed frame’s top bunk platform (where the mattress rests) and the thickness of the mattress you plan to use. The remaining distance is the usable headroom.

For safety and comfort, the top bunk sleeper should have at least 75 to 90 centimeters of headroom. This clearance allows the child to sit up comfortably in bed, read, or change clothes without bumping their head against the ceiling. If your ceiling is 2.4 meters high and the top bunk platform sits at 1.5 meters, a standard 15-centimeter (6-inch) mattress leaves only 75 centimeters of headroom, which is the absolute minimum recommended.

Furthermore, you must evaluate the vertical clearance at the slide’s starting platform. The transition point where the child sits down to slide must be free of overhead obstructions. If the child has to duck excessively or risks hitting their head when entering the slide, the setup becomes a safety hazard.

Always check the ceiling area for potential hazards. Ensure the bed and slide are positioned far away from ceiling fans, hanging light fixtures, air conditioning vents, or sloped ceiling joints. A child standing on the top bunk or preparing to slide must never be within arm’s reach of a moving ceiling fan or a hot light bulb.

Step-by-Step Room Measurement and Layout Planning

To ensure a successful installation, you should follow a structured measurement and planning workflow. Do not rely on visual estimation; instead, take physical measurements and create a physical layout map directly on your bedroom floor.

Step 1: Measure the Room’s Core Dimensions Use a reliable steel measuring tape to record the maximum length, width, and height of the bedroom. Measure along the baseboards and also check the height at multiple points in the room, as floors and ceilings are rarely perfectly level.

Step 2: Map Architectural Obstacles and Door Swings Identify and mark all fixed elements in the room. This includes the swing radius of the entry door and wardrobe doors, the location of windows and their sills, electrical outlets, light switches, and wall-mounted air conditioning units. The bed frame and slide must not block access to any of these elements. For example, ensure that opening a closet door will not strike the side of the bed or the slide.

Step 3: Identify Primary Walking Paths Determine how traffic flows through the room. There must be a clear path from the entry door to the closet, desk, and window. The slide’s landing zone should not overlap with these primary pathways, as a child sliding down could easily collide with someone entering the room.

Step 4: Use Painter’s Tape to Create a Floor Mockup Once you have the exact dimensions of your chosen slide bunk bed from the manufacturer, use blue painter’s tape or laid-out newspapers to tape the complete footprint on the floor. Outline the rectangular bed frame, the ladder or stairs, and the diagonal projection of the slide, including the 1-meter safety landing buffer.

Step 5: Test the Flow and Clearances Walk around the taped outline. Open and close the wardrobe doors, step into the room, and simulate walking past the slide. This physical mockup is the most effective way to identify tight squeezes or layout conflicts before spending thousands of pesos (₱) on delivery and assembly.

Common Sizing Mistakes to Avoid in Compact Bedrooms

When furnishing a small bedroom, minor planning oversights can lead to major functional issues. One of the most common mistakes is ignoring the impact of mattress thickness on safety. Purchasing a mattress that is too thick for the top bunk not only reduces precious headroom but also compromises the effectiveness of the safety guardrails. Most manufacturers specify a maximum mattress thickness (typically 12 to 15 centimeters) to ensure the guardrails extend high enough above the mattress surface to prevent falls.

Another frequent error is failing to account for the slide’s landing buffer. Parents often focus solely on fitting the physical slide into the room, forgetting that a child needs space to exit. If the slide terminates right against a wall or the sharp edge of a desk, the risk of injury increases significantly.

Additionally, never assume that all beds labeled as “single” or “twin” share identical outer dimensions. Frame designs vary wildly; a rustic wooden slide bunk bed will have a much thicker, heavier frame than a minimalist metal option. Always verify the total assembled dimensions—including the slide, ladders, and stairs—directly from the product’s official assembly manual rather than relying on generic retail category descriptions.

Frequently Asked Questions (FAQ)

Can a slide bunk bed fit in a room with low ceilings?

Yes, but you must select a low-profile, mid-sleeper, or low bunk bed design specifically engineered for limited vertical space. These specialized frames keep the top bunk platform closer to the floor (often around 110 to 120 centimeters high), which preserves safe headroom even in rooms with 2.4-meter ceilings. Always calculate the exact clearance by subtracting the platform height and mattress thickness from your ceiling height before purchasing.

Do I need extra clearance around the slide for safety?

Yes, maintaining a clear safety buffer around the slide is essential. You must keep a zone of at least 90 to 100 centimeters at the bottom of the slide entirely free of furniture, toys, and high-traffic pathways. Additionally, ensure there is at least 50 centimeters of lateral clearance on either side of the slide to prevent the child’s arms or legs from striking nearby walls or furniture during descent.
